Transaction 63c6be1d740b1a4ee46f01d958b3a48bcd98fdd3e0ece01b2405fc4d210bdefb
1 Input
1 Output
-
63c6be1d740b1a4ee46f01d958b3a48bcd98fdd3e0ece01b2405fc4d210bdefb:0
- value
- 399954735
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32a95c3e3d9e245a633ebe7d00c4ce8b0fa1a108 OP_EQUAL
- address
- 36JtbVmw2idH7frvSYL3ZzamCmtywqYLKm